Average Salary for Heavy Equipment Operators in Canada
| Experience Level | Hourly Wage (CAD) | Annual Salary (CAD) |
|---|---|---|
| Entry-Level | $22 – $28 | $45,000 – $58,000 |
| Mid-Level | $28 – $38 | $58,000 – $78,000 |
| Experienced | $38 – $50+ | $78,000 – $100,000+ |
💡 Overtime, remote site bonuses, and union benefits can significantly increase earnings.
Visa Options for Heavy Equipment Operator Jobs in Canada
1. Temporary Foreign Worker Program (TFWP)
- Requires a Labour Market Impact Assessment (LMIA)
- Employer proves no Canadian worker is available
- Most common route for visa sponsorship
2. Express Entry (Federal Skilled Trades Program)
- Ideal for skilled operators with experience
- Points-based immigration system
- Leads directly to permanent residence (PR)
3. Provincial Nominee Program (PNP)
- Provinces nominate workers in high-demand occupations
- Faster PR pathway after job offer
4. Atlantic Immigration Program (AIP)
- For jobs in Atlantic Canada
- Employer-driven PR pathway
Visa Requirements for Employment
To qualify for a Canada work visa sponsorship, you must meet:
- Valid international passport
- Job offer from a Canadian employer
- LMIA (if required)
- Proof of work experience (2–5 years preferred)
- Educational certificates (optional but beneficial)
- English proficiency (IELTS or equivalent)
- Medical examination
- Police clearance certificate

Step-by-Step: How to Get Visa Sponsorship
Step 1: Search for Jobs
Use verified platforms:
- Job Bank Canada (official government site)
- Indeed Canada
- Workopolis
- LinkedIn Jobs
Step 2: Apply to LMIA-Approved Employers
Focus on companies actively hiring foreign workers.
Step 3: Attend Interviews
- Be ready for virtual interviews
- Highlight machinery experience and safety training
Step 4: Receive Job Offer + LMIA
- Employer applies for LMIA
- Once approved, you proceed with visa application
Step 5: Apply for Work Permit
- Submit application online or via visa application center
Step 6: Biometrics & Medical
- Required for visa processing
Step 7: Travel to Canada
- Start working legally under employer sponsorship

Permanent Residency (PR) Pathways
Heavy equipment operators can transition to PR via:
- Express Entry (Skilled Trades)
- Provincial Nominee Programs (PNP)
- Canadian Experience Class (after working in Canada)
